Omega-3 long chain polyunsaturated fatty acid supplementation (-3 LCPUFA) for treatment of Autism Spectrum Disorder (ASD) is popular. The results of previous systematic reviews and meta-analyses of -3 LCPUFA supplementation on ASD outcomes were inconclusive. Two meta-analyses were conducted; meta-analysis 1 compared blood levels of LCPUFA and their ratios arachidonic acid (ARA) to docosahexaenoic acid (DHA), ARA to eicosapentaenoic acid (EPA), or total -6 to total -3 LCPUFA in ASD to those of typically developing individuals (with no neurodevelopmental disorders), and meta-analysis 2 compared the effects of -3 LCPUFA supplementation to placebo on symptoms of ASD. Case-control studies and randomised controlled trials (RCTs) were identified searching electronic databases up to May, 2016. Mean differences were pooled and analysed using inverse variance models. Heterogeneity was assessed using ² statistic. Fifteen case-control studies ( = 1193) were reviewed. Compared with typically developed, ASD populations had lower DHA (-2.14 [95% CI -3.22 to -1.07]; < 0.0001; ² = 97%), EPA (-0.72 [95% CI -1.25 to -0.18]; = 0.008; ² = 88%), and ARA (-0.83 [95% CI, -1.48 to -0.17]; = 0.01; ² = 96%) and higher total -6 LCPUFA to -3 LCPUFA ratio (0.42 [95% CI 0.06 to 0.78]; = 0.02; ² = 74%). Four RCTs were included in meta-analysis 2 ( = 107). Compared with placebo, -3 LCPUFA improved social interaction (-1.96 [95% CI -3.5 to -0.34]; = 0.02; ² = 0) and repetitive and restricted interests and behaviours (-1.08 [95% CI -2.17 to -0.01]; = 0.05; ² = 0). Populations with ASD have lower -3 LCPUFA status and -3 LCPUFA supplementation can potentially improve some ASD symptoms. Further research with large sample size and adequate study duration is warranted to confirm the efficacy of -3 LCPUFA.
